WebApart gives the partial fraction decomposition of a rational expression. Apart [ expr , var ] writes expr as a polynomial in var together with a sum of ratios of polynomials, where the degree in var of each numerator polynomial is less than that of the corresponding denominator polynomial. Web17 Jun 2024 · In algebra, the partial fraction decomposition or partial fraction expansion of a rational fraction (that is, a fraction such that the numerator and the denominator are both polynomials) is an operation that consists of expressing the fraction as a sum of a polynomial (possibly zero) and one or several fractions with a simpler denominator.

WebPartial fractions mc-TY-partialfractions-2009-1 An algebraic fraction such as 3x+5 2x2 − 5x− 3 can often be broken down into simpler parts called ... An algebraic fraction is a fraction in which the numerator and denominator are both polynomial expressions. Web3 Oct 2024 · This is the principal by which we shall determine the unknown coefficients in our partial fraction decomposition. Theorem 8.11. Suppose anxn + an − 1xn − 1 + ⋯ + a2x2 + a1x + a0 = bmxm + mm − 1xm − 1 + ⋯ + b2x2 + b1x + b0. for all x in an open interval I. Then n = m and ai = bi for all i = 1…n.
